Voting and Lynching
  1. Each Day, you may vote for a player to be lynched using a bold vote command. For example, vote: Virgilijus.
  2. To unvote, use the command unvote. For example, unvote vote: Tom. You must unvote before voting another player.
  3. No lynch is a viable lynch choice and a majority will end the Day without a lynch. For example, vote: No Lynch.
  4. The Day will end when a majority lynch is decided or a pre-set deadline has been reached. If deadline is reached without a majority lynch decided, there will be no lynch.
  5. After the majority lynch has been decided but before the lynch scene is posted, there will be a Twilight phase. Everyone can post in this phase, including the lynch majority target. After the lynch scene is posted, the game will move to Night.
  6. There is no posting in this thread during the Night phase.
